Voice Integration: Your Remote as a Personal Smart Assistant
Many contemporary remotes come equipped with built-in voice recognition, turning your remote into a hands-free smart assistant. With a simple command, you can pause a show, change channel, search for content, or insert subtitles—all without lifting a finger. This voice-enabled control integrates artificial intelligence to learn your preferences, suggesting shows, adjusting settings, and creating routines that adapt to your viewing habits. This seamless interaction reduces friction, making entertainment smarter and more intuitive.

Remote-Controlled Smart Home Synergy
Your remote doesn’t just interface with TVs; it connects your whole smart home environment. With compatible remotes, you can dim lights, adjust thermostats, or lock doors—all from the comfort of your couch—while watching a show. This holistic control fosters a balanced, ambient experience where entertainment and living spaces are seamlessly unified.
